Decommissioning Services

Decommissioning services consists of the radioactive materials license termination of particular facilities. There are many different reasons why a facility might require decommissioning in any given industry, but it typically takes place when operations have come to a halt due to company relocation or closure. The objective is to keep future occupants safe with a timely release of facilities. Standards Used

  • NUREG 1757, Consolidated NMSS Decommissioning Guidance
  • NUREG 1505, A Nonparametric Statistical Methodology for the Design and Analysis of Final Status Decommissioning Surveys
  • NUREG 1575, Mutli-Agency Radiation Survey and Site Investigation Manual (MARSSIM)
  • NUREG 1549, Decision Methods for Dose Assessment to Comply With Radiological Criteria for License Termination
  • NUREG 1507, Minimum Detectable Concentrations with Typical Radiation Survey Instruments for Various Contaminants and Field Conditions
  • NUREG/CR-5512, Residual Radioactive Contamination from Decommissioning
  • NUREG 1748, Environmental Review Guidance for Licensing Actions Associated with NMSS Programs
